The Referrals Manager leads Gracelight's centralized Referrals and Medical Records departments. The role is accountable for timely completion of specialty referrals and authorizations, accurate and compliant release and retention of medical records, and the productivity, quality, and customer service performance of both departments. The Manager supervises departmental staff, owns the workflows and systems that move referrals and records, and works with providers, health center leadership, managed care, revenue cycle, quality, and IS to close referral loops and reduce delays.

ESSENTIAL JOB D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  1. Directs day-to-day operations of the Referrals and Medical Records departments, including workflows, policies, procedures, and service standards.
  2. Supervises referral coordinators and medical records staff: hires, trains, schedules, coaches, evaluates, and manages performance; distributes workload to meet turnaround and productivity targets.
  3. Ensures referrals and authorizations are processed accurately and on time in compliance with payer requirements, and that no referral is lost between order and completed specialty visit.
  4. Ensures medical records are released, stored, and retained in accordance with HIPAA, California law, HRSA requirements, and organizational policy, and that records requests meet turnaround standards.
  5. Sets departmental KPIs and monitors performance on referral turnaround, authorization completion, referral aging and closure, records turnaround, productivity, and customer service; identifies gaps and leads corrective action and quality improvement.
  6. Prepares monthly department reports and dashboards for leadership and recommends process changes based on the data.
  7. Manages the department budget and staffing levels; identifies opportunities to reduce delays and improve productivity, including through technology.
  8. Owns the department's use of Epic, referral management tools, managed care portals, and LANES; optimizes configuration, tracking, and reporting with IS.
  9. Maintains working relationships with managed care organizations, specialty providers, hospitals, and imaging centers to improve authorization turnaround and specialty access.
  10. Works with providers, health center leadership, Patient Access, Revenue Cycle, Quality, and Compliance to resolve referral and records issues affecting patient care, and support audits, surveys, and managed care reviews.
  11. Performs all other duties as assigned.
Qualifications
  • Three or more years of experience in referral management, medical records, patient access, or healthcare operations; bachelor's degree in healthcare administration, health information management, business, public health, or a related field preferred.
  • Two or more years of supervisory experience managing staff performance.
  • Working knowledge of Medi-Cal and Medicare managed care authorization processes, referral coordination, HIPAA, and California medical records law.
  • Experience with an electronic health record (OCHIN Epic preferred), referral management systems, managed care portals, and LANES.
  • RHIT or RHIA certification preferred.
  • Ability to build reports and dashboards and analyze departmental performance data; advanced Excel.
  • FQHC or community health center experience preferred.
  • Bilingual English/Spanish strongly preferred.
  • Personal cell phone available for business use; stipend provided per policy.
  • Employment is conditioned on background check, Title XXII clearance, OIG/SAM screening, and health screening.

What We Do

Gracelight Community Health is a federally qualified health center providing comprehensive primary care, pediatrics, obstetrics, dentistry, and behavioral health services to communities, regardless of their ability to pay.
